logo

Output 14dd325aa8c0a150fc5e2f252aa94f520b25a8e4c1a91ea39b4700c290870606:3

value
989577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 498f9c66f2f36d8ad6a2174d9caa6eee6e7db53e OP_EQUAL
address
38PyHoysHnkRK8TY2k6pcELXuPMsTfjBfB
transaction
14dd325aa8c0a150fc5e2f252aa94f520b25a8e4c1a91ea39b4700c290870606